One world class player is apparently dreaming of joining Chelsea this summer when the next transfer window opens, according to a report from the local media.

Chelsea are going to be pretty busy in the transfer market at the end of the season, with plans seemingly for outgoings as well as arrivals.

The striker position is the main position that is always spoken about as being the priority for the club this season.

Nicolas Jackson is doing well of late, but he is the only recognised number 9 left at the Stamford Bridge club, with Armando Broja largely expected to be sold this summer.

Chelsea need competition and quality reinforcements to come in, especially in the centre forward area.

One player they are linked to like every other day right now is Napoli striker Victor Osimhen, who is going to be leaving his club this summer.

According to the latest report from La Gazzetta dello Sport, Osimhen wants to join Chelsea and the Blues can turn the striker’s dream into reality by paying a release clause of circa €120-130m.

PSG have also been linked with Osimhen and are looking to challenge Chelsea for his capture.

Should Chelsea be looking to spend another £100m plus on one single player?

Manchester United target statement Victor Osimhen signing but face major  competition from one European giant | The Independent

No, is my opinion, in short.

We should be smarter. There are about 3 to 4 positions we need to sign in this summer, we should be wise and spread our budget and be able to buy in more positions. I don’t get the sense is spending another £100m plus on one single player and then having to fight FFP and PSR rules once again down the line.

Someone like Benjamin Sesko who is available at half the price of Osimhen would represent a smarter buy in my opinion. Or an proven and experienced Premier League striker such as Ivan Toney would be a better direction to take.
